
Wondering what a film review is doing in a surf magazine? When the main star happens to be one of Manila’s pioneering surf idols you begin to see the connection. I wrote this article for the Philippine Star Entertainment Section after Alagwa (Breakaway) made its USA debut back in January 2013 for the Palm Springs International Film Festival.
Breakaway has returned to American audiences and will screen at the Newport Beach Film Festival, April 25 – May 2 . The film’s director Ian Lorenos and producer/actor Jericho Rosales will be at the screenings to greet the Orange County audience.
This is an important film that addresses human trafficking, a sensitive issue that is more rampant than we realize. The work of Ian and Jericho bring Pinoy Indie Cinema to the forefront and make us all proud. The Philippine audience has to be patient and await the Film’s Philippine debut after it has finished it’s Global Film Festival run. Believe me, it’s well worth the wait.

Breakaway will screen April 28, 4:30pm at the Triangle and April 30th 3:00pm at Fashion Island Cinema
